Plane crash: Lt. Gen Attahiru: Senator Moro mourns Chief of Army Staff, others, calls for investigation

The Senator Representing the good people of Benue South Senatorial District, Comrade Abba Moro, receives with shock the death of Nigeria’s Chief of Army Staff, Lt. Gen. Ibrahim Attahiru.

Report says the army chief and other personnel lost their lives after a military plane crashed near the Kaduna Airport on Friday.

Senator Moro, who doubles as Deputy Chairman, Senate Committees on Army and Inter-parliamentary Affairs, describes the death of Lt. Gen Attahiru as unfortunate.

The lawmaker decries the sudden death of the Army Chief at a time the nation needed his service in the ongoing fight against terrorism.

He commiserates with his immediate family and the Nigerian Army over the sad loss.

Senator Moro calls on the Accident Investigation Bureau and other relevant agencies to urgently investigate the what led to the air mishap.
